The city's controversial red-light traffic cameras issued 46,000 tickets last year. CJ. Lin in the Daily News.

And it only took all of four police officers

sitting at a few computer monitors to run the system.

Just one of the officers manning the computers at the Los Angeles Police Department's Photo Red Light Unit can do the equivalent work of some 100 out on the streets, according to Sgt. Matthew MacWillie, who oversees the program.
